NEW YORK (Wireless Flash) -- The 1933 movie "King Kong" is living up to it's giant image -- at least when it comes to the price of memorabilia. A "King Kong" movie poster featuring the famous ape grasping a broken airplane in one hand and star Fay Wray in the other will go on the auction block this Friday in New York. Sotheby's auction house says the starting bid for the poster will be $100,000. Other pricey movie posters that will be auctioned off include... -- A Three Stooges poster for the 1934 film "Three Little Pigskins." It features a shot of the Stooges lifting a football- helmet clad Lucille Ball. Starting bid: $70,000. -- A poster for the 1925 Charlie Chaplin film, "The Gold Rush," has a pre-sale value of $18,000. -- And, finally, the only known copy of a poster for "It's A Wonderful Life" could sell for as much as $15,000.
